Understanding Creatine

Creatine is an amino-acid-like compound that is found naturally in the human body. It is produced endogenously by the kidneys, pancreas and liver, from complex chemical reactions involving the amino acids arginine, glycine and methionine, and is stored in the brain, liver and muscles as phosphocreatine (PCr).

You will of course find creatine in dietary animal proteins such as red meat, poultry and fish, with lower levels present in dairy. From a dietary perspective, there isn't quite enough creatine available to move the dial on your performance gains, with a typical 1 lb of uncooked steak delivering between 1-2g of creatine. In order for you to reach the dosage levels available in most supplements, you’d have to consume almost inhuman amounts of meat.

Vegan and vegetarian consumers are missing out on the inclusion of creatine rich food sources, but this can easily be remedied through regular supplementation. As creatine monohydrate is now synthetically produced to enhance purity and quality, no animal origin materials are used in its production, making the journey of figuring out what meets those dietary restrictions that much easier.

Is Creatine a Steroid?

Is creatine an anabolic steroid? No, it is not. It is not a hormone, and does not behave the same way a hormone does. However, its effects on muscle building, muscle endurance and muscle performance can be similar in action, but without the negative effects.

Some people may avoid taking creatine due to the perceived health risks associated with it, such as kidney or liver damage. We aren't quite sure where this rumour started, or how creatine monohydrate became the scapegoat for this health concern. Several clinical trials implemented strict clinical surveillance measures, including continual monitoring of laboratory markers of kidney health, inflammation, and liver function; none of which were negatively impacted by the respective creatine supplementation interventions. In fact, the strongest supporting evidence for the safety of creatine is the classification of creatine as a Generally Recognised as Safe ingredient by the United States Food and Drug Administration in 2020.

 

What Does it Do and How Does it Work?

Although we love the science, it can get confusing. We promise this is the only section which may prove a bit tricky to get your head around! 

The fair majority (around 95%) of creatine is stored in the skeletal muscles, liver and brain in the form of phosphocreatine (PCr). This immediately available molecule supports the ATP-PC energy cycle, helping your body to transport a high-energy molecule called adenosine triphosphate (ATP).

For a muscle to contract, ATP must break off a phosphate group, leaving behind adenosine diphosphate (ADP). The body cannot use ADP for energy, so ADP takes a phosphate from the body’s PCr store to form more ATP. When you have more ATP, your recovery between sets improves significantly. Supplementing with creatine increases the body’s store of PCr, which means ATP can be reformed quicker, specifically in the working muscle tissue.

Supplementing with creatine increases the body’s ability to rapidly produce energy and therefore leads to increased muscle growth and stamina due to more work being able to be put in before fatigue hits you. The goal is to lift heavier, for longer!



Does Creatine Cause Weight Gain?

For those who are looking to lose weight, you may be reluctant to supplement with creatine due to the fact that it does cause some weight gain, especially when you start taking it. Research has thoroughly documented that creatine supplements cause a rapid increase of weight, but this is short-term as it is water weight. This is because it alters your stored water content by driving additional water, creatine and the valuable carbohydrates and amino acids into your muscle cells. 

Weight gain from supplementing with creatine is not due to gaining fat, but due to an increase of water stores in your muscles, making the muscle look bigger and fuller which is an important element of the creatine's functional purpose. Over time, with training and the correct nutrition, you will still lose total body fat, but should experience an increase in lean muscle tissue mass. However, if you are taking creatine, it is important to stay well-hydrated.

To recap, while an initial weight gain may be due to an increase in water, research shows that creatine supplementation, alongside resistance training, results in an increase in lean body mass and decrease in fat mass, leading to an improvement in body composition and muscle gain.

 

Boosts Athletic Performance

Improves exercise performance 

One of the primary reasons athletes and fitness enthusiasts use creatine supplements is to improve their athletic performance. Due to the increase of PCr stores in the body, it means ATP is able to be produced quicker which contributes to greater exercise performance. This can result in being able to go harder for longer and lift heavier. 

Increases muscle mass and strength 

Having more ATP in your energy system means that you’re capable of carrying out more intense workouts and lifting heavier. Research has shown that creatine supplementation can increase maximal strength and power by 5-15% As well as this, with creatine drawing water into the muscle, this increases muscle mass naturally as well as improves both performance recovery and ability. 

 

Creatine and Brain Health

Improves mood and cognitive function

Creatine is not only found in muscles but also in the brain, where it plays a role in energy metabolism. The brain requires a significant amount of ATP for energy, and just like in muscles, creatine can help increase the available ATP. Some research suggests that creatine supplementation may have potential benefits for cognitive function and mental clarity, especially in tasks that require short-term memory and rapid information processing. 

Potential health benefits

Beyond its performance-related advantages, creatine monohydrate may offer potential health benefits. Some studies have suggested that supplementation could have positive effects on conditions such as Parkinson's disease, muscular dystrophy, and even certain neurological disorders. 

 

Creatine Enhances Recovery Post-Workout

Another significant benefit of creatine supplementation is its role in recovery post-workout. Intense workouts often lead to muscle damage, inflammation, and oxidative stress. Creatine has been found to reduce these factors, thereby aiding in faster recovery.

Studies have shown that creatine supplementation can decrease muscle soreness and inflammation following intense exercise. It also helps replenish ATP stores faster, which can speed up recovery time between sets or workouts.


Is Creatine Safe?

When used as directed, creatine is generally safe for most people. The most common side effect is weight gain due to water retention in the muscles. Some people may experience stomach cramping or nausea if they consume too much at once or without enough water.

One common concern is the initial water weight gain associated with creatine, but it's important to remember that this is temporary. Over time, when combined with proper training and nutrition, creatine supplementation has been shown to increase lean body mass and contribute to a better overall body composition.

However, it's always recommended to consult with a healthcare provider before starting any new supplement regimen, especially for those with kidney disease or other medical conditions.
